Javascript для изображения капчи в html - PullRequest
1 голос
/ 12 марта 2009

Я хочу JavaScript для изображения капчи в HTML-код.
Whcih генерирует изображения динамически и сопоставляет данный символ с символами изображения. Прежде чем войти на новую страницу, необходимо проверить, одинаковы ли они или нет.
Я хочу создать его по-своему. Как мне этого добиться?

Заранее спасибо,
Правин Дж

Ответы [ 2 ]

4 голосов
/ 12 марта 2009

Я хочу JavaScript для изображения капчи в HTML-код. Whcih генерирует изображения динамически и сопоставляет данный символ с символами изображения. Прежде чем войти на новую страницу, необходимо проверить, одинаковы ли оба

Хотя вы можете написать некоторые фигуры в элементе , SVG или VML - или даже (в браузерах, отличных от IE) создать изображение с URL-адресом «data:», созданным из значений пикселей - в этом нет смысла.

Любой полностью клиентский подход к капче уже скомпрометирован, потому что он должен знать «правильный» ответ, чтобы проверить. Злоумышленник может просто запустить JavaScript, чтобы узнать ответ. Или просто отключите JavaScript, чтобы избежать проверок.

Для выполнения капч вам необходим серверный сценарий, к которому у злоумышленника нет доступа для выполнения работы.

4 голосов
/ 12 марта 2009

Используйте recaptcha . Это то, что использует stackoverflow!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...